The Broadcasters' Decision: What We Know About Jean-Claude Dassier Écarté
The core information emerging from sources like OnePlanete confirms that both CNews, a leading French news channel, and Europe 1, a major national radio station, have jointly decided to remove Jean-Claude Dassier from his position as a 'chroniqueur' (commentator or columnist). The phrase "jusqu'à nouvel ordre" (until further notice) underscores the indefinite nature of this suspension, suggesting a serious review of his future with the networks. This decision is not merely a temporary absence but indicates a more profound re-evaluation by the broadcasters regarding his continued presence on their platforms.

Who is Jean-Claude Dassier? A Look at His Storied Career
To fully grasp the significance of Jean-Claude Dassier's sidelining, it's essential to understand his prominent standing within French media and beyond. Born in 1941, Dassier boasts a career spanning several decades, marked by diverse and influential roles. He began his professional life as a journalist, quickly ascending through the ranks. His tenure includes significant positions such as:
- Director of Information at TF1: A major French television channel, where he oversaw news operations and wielded considerable influence over the national media agenda.
- President of Olympique de Marseille: Beyond journalism, Dassier famously took the helm of one of France's most iconic football clubs, demonstrating his leadership capabilities in a high-pressure, public-facing role.
- Commentator and Columnist: Post-TF1 and OM, Dassier transitioned into a role as a regular commentator and analyst for various media outlets, including CNews and Europe 1. In this capacity, he became known for his often strong opinions and direct style, participating in debates on current affairs, politics, and sports.
His career trajectory highlights a figure deeply embedded in the French public sphere, with a reputation for being an opinionated and sometimes controversial voice. His insights, drawn from years at the highest levels of journalism and management, have made him a recognizable and often provocative figure on air. Unpacking the Reasons Behind Media Suspensions
While the exact reasons behind the decision to have jean-claude dassier écarté have not been publicly detailed by CNews or Europe 1, such actions in the media world typically stem from a range of factors. These considerations are crucial for broadcasters aiming to maintain their credibility, adhere to ethical standards, and manage their public image. Common reasons for suspending or sidelining commentators include:
- Violation of Editorial Guidelines: Every news organization has a set of editorial standards regarding accuracy, impartiality, language, and the appropriateness of commentary. A commentator who deviates from these guidelines, especially with sensitive topics, can put the broadcaster in a difficult position.
- Controversial or Offensive Statements: In an age of instant public feedback and social media scrutiny, remarks deemed offensive, discriminatory, or excessively provocative can quickly escalate into a public relations crisis. Broadcasters often act swiftly to distance themselves from such statements.
- Misinformation or Spreading Unverified Claims: With the ongoing battle against 'fake news,' media outlets are under immense pressure to ensure the information presented on their platforms is accurate. Commentators who repeatedly spread misinformation, even if unintentional, pose a risk to the outlet's journalistic integrity.
- Ethical Breaches or Conflicts of Interest: Allegations of unethical conduct, undeclared conflicts of interest, or behavior that undermines the trust placed in media professionals can lead to immediate suspensions.
- Legal Ramifications: Statements that could lead to defamation lawsuits, incitement to hatred, or other legal challenges can prompt broadcasters to take protective action.
- Public and Advertiser Pressure: Significant public outcry, often amplified by social media campaigns, or pressure from advertisers can force broadcasters to reconsider their talent lineup.
- Internal Policy Changes: Sometimes, broadcasters revise their internal policies regarding the conduct of their staff and commentators, leading to the sidelining of individuals who no longer align with the updated corporate vision or values.
It's important to note that media organizations often prefer to handle such matters discreetly, avoiding public disclosure of specific reasons to protect the privacy of the individual involved and to manage potential legal or reputational fallout.
